DTMF fails on outbound calls with CUCM 11.5 -> SIP Trunk -> CUBE -> SIP ISP. I have a CUBE that works with both inbound/outbound calls. However when I place an outbound call to an external source through the SIP ISPI can't pass DTMF. Entered digits does is not recognized.
dial-peer voice 1 voip
description OUTGOING FROM CUBE TO ISP SIP
translation-profile outgoing ISP-SIP-OUTBOUND
session protocol sipv2
session target sip-server
voice-class codec 10
voice-class sip profiles 1
fax protocol none
I use "dtmf-relay sip-info or sip-kpml" for Out-of-band on DTMF. When I place all dial-peer to "dtmf-relay rtp-nte", DTMF works perfect on outbound calls.
Is there a command I'm missing? I need Out-of-band setup for compliance.
Please give it a try by replacing "dtmf-relay sip-info" to "dtmf-relay rtp-nte".
Here is a document reference for this:
Does the carrier accept the out of band DTMF?